Skogfjorden is a Norwegian language village and campsite affiliated with the Concordia Language Villages. It is located at the Concordia site at Turtle River Lake near Bemidji, Minnesota, United States. International recognition

The Ambassador of Norway, Knut Vollebæk, visited the village in 2003.{{cite web |url=http://dept.cord.edu/clv/newsletter/fall03/globalconnect.html |title=An Exciting Summer at Concordia Language Villages |author= |date=2003 |website=Concordia Language Villages |access-date=13 July 2015 }}

His Majesty King Harald V of Norway has granted royal patronage to Skogfjorden. Patronage is an affirmation from the Royal Family of Norway of the quality educational programming of Concordia Language Villages.

History

Concordia Language Villages began offering Norwegian programs in 1963 and opened an architecturally-authentic, year-round Norwegian Language Village on Turtle River Lake near Bemidji, Minnesota in 1971.
